  1. High demand for analytics professionals

The current demand for qualified data professionals is just the beginning. Technology professionals who are experienced in analytics are in high demand, as organizations are looking for ways to exploit the power of big data. The number of jobs in the  Big Data industry has increased by 106% from the year of 2014 to 2017 substantially . This apparent surge is due to the increased number of organizations implementing analytics and thereby looking for analytics professionals. Through a study from QuinStreet Inc., it was revealed that the trend of implementing big data analytics is growing and is considered to be a high priority among U.S. businesses. A majority of the organizations are either in the process of implementing it, or they’re actively planning to add this feature within the next two years.

  1. Huge Job Opportunities & Meeting the Skill Gap

The demand for analytics professionals is increasing steadily, but there is a huge deficit on the supply side. This is happening globally and is not restricted to any part of the world. In spite of Big Data Analytics being an in-demand position, there is still a large number of unfilled jobs across the globe due to a shortage of required skills. Those interested in learning the skills needed for this quickly-growing profession can learn everything they need through an online certification course.

A McKinsey Global Institute study states that the U.S. will face a shortage of about 190,000 data scientists and 1.5 million managers and analysts who can understand and make decisions using big data by 2018. India currently has the highest concentration of analytics globally. Despite this, the scarcity of data analytics talent is particularly acute, and demand for talent is expected to be on the higher side as more global organizations are outsourcing their work.

  1. Salary Aspects

Strong demand for data analytics skills is boosting the wages for qualified professionals. According to the 2015 Skills and Salary Survey Report  by cmo.com that the Institute of Analytics Professionals of Australia (IAPA) published, the annual median salary for data analysts is $130,000: a four percent increase from last year. A look at the salary trend for big data analytics in the UK also indicates positive and exponential growth. A quick search on Itjobswatch.co.uk shows a median salary of £62,500 in early 2016 for big data analytics jobs, as compared to £55,000 in 2015. A year-on-year median salary change of +13.63% is also observed.

  1. Flexibility of working in any sector

As a data analytics professional, you’re not usually limited to working in a particular industry, which can be a huge advantage. Every industry benefits from data analytics. Some of the core industries where you can see a high demand for data analytics professionals include financial, healthcare, retail, logistics and human resource management. For example, if an online retailer launches an AdWords campaign, a data analyst can be an invaluable asset by evaluating the data from that campaign. This can allow the retailer to see what worked, what didn’t, and how future campaigns should be executed.
